We are seeking a scientist who, ideally, will have some laboratory experience in molecular biology techniques, and an eye for detail. The successful candidate may be a recent graduate or may have acquired appropriate experience within a laboratory and will understand the principles of confidentiality and data protection. You will be responsible for a wide range of tasks including extracting DNA, processing DNA samples for sequencing, data analysis, as well as participation in other research projects. Candidates will also be expected to cover within other departments within the facility when required.
Applicants should possess good interpersonal skills, practice meticulous record keeping and be conscientious and reliable in their approach to work. DNA sequencing, genotyping/gene expression and robotics experience would be an advantage, as would any experience of working in a service orientated industry.

Summary:
The overall objective is to deliver, either with single responsibility, or in shared projects, services from the portfolio to customers of Source BioScience.
Data is to be delivered promptly, within agreed KPIs, in approved formats whilst keeping meticulously maintained records using LIMS and paper-based formats as appropriate.
The post holder will be expected to perform data analysis.
They will also be expected to undertake general laboratory maintenance and routine tasks including preparation of buffers and reagents, lab tidying etc. The post-holder will be expected to maintain quality standards.
